Class java.io.FilePermission
Synopsis
This class represents permission to read, write, delete, or execute files. The name encapsulated in this permission is the name of the file; the string “<<ALL_FILES>>” represents all files, while an asterisk represents all files in a directory and a hyphen represents all files that descend from a directory. The actions for this permission are read, write, execute, and delete.
Class Definition
public final class java.io.FilePermission extends java.security.Permission implements java.io.Serializable { // Constructors public FilePermission(String, String); // Instance Methods public boolean equals(Object); public String getActions(); public int hashCode(); public boolean implies(Permission); public PermissionCollection newPermissionCollection(); }
